x^2=15/100
We move all terms to the left:
x^2-(15/100)=0
We add all the numbers together, and all the variables
x^2-(+15/100)=0
We get rid of parentheses
x^2-15/100=0
We multiply all the terms by the denominator
x^2*100-15=0
Wy multiply elements
100x^2-15=0
a = 100; b = 0; c = -15;
Δ = b2-4ac
Δ = 02-4·100·(-15)
Δ = 6000
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$
The end solution:
$\sqrt{\Delta}=\sqrt{6000}=\sqrt{400*15}=\sqrt{400}*\sqrt{15}=20\sqrt{15}$$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(0)-20\sqrt{15}}{2*100}=\frac{0-20\sqrt{15}}{200} =-\frac{20\sqrt{15}}{200} =-\frac{\sqrt{15}}{10} $$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(0)+20\sqrt{15}}{2*100}=\frac{0+20\sqrt{15}}{200} =\frac{20\sqrt{15}}{200} =\frac{\sqrt{15}}{10} $
